본문 바로가기

AWS

[AWS] RDS for SQL Server – Developer Edition 지원

Amazon RDS for SQL Server에서 Developer Edition을 공식 지원하기 시작했습니다.
이 변경은 2025년 12월 기준으로 발표된 사항이며, 기존 Express / Web / Standard / Enterprise Edition과는 다릅니다.

TL;DR

  • Developer Edition은 SQL Server Enterprise Edition과 동일한 기능 세트를 제공합니다.
  • 차이점은 라이선스 사용 목적으로, Developer Edition은 개발 및 테스트 환경 전용입니다.
  • RDS에서 제공되므로, 사용자는 SQL Server 라이선스를 직접 구매하지 않아도 됩니다.
  • 비용 구조는 RDS 인스턴스 비용 + 스토리지 비용만 발생하며, SQL Server 라이선스 비용은 포함되지 않습니다.

즉, 기능은 Enterprise급이지만 비용은 상대적으로 낮은 개발/검증용 환경을 만들 수 있다는 의미입니다.

2. 지원 목적과 AWS가 이 기능을 추가한 이유

공식 문서와 릴리즈 내용을 종합하면, 이 기능은 다음과 같은 요구를 충족하기 위해 추가된 것으로 보입니다.

  • Enterprise 기능(Always On, 고급 인덱싱, 성능 기능 등)을 개발 단계에서 검증
  • 로컬 PC나 EC2에 직접 SQL Server를 설치하지 않고도 관리형 환경에서 개발
  • 운영 환경(Standard / Enterprise)과 기능 차이 없는 개발 환경 구성

특히, 운영은 Standard 또는 Enterprise, 개발은 Developer Edition으로 분리하는 구조를 AWS RDS 레벨에서 공식적으로 지원하게 된 점이 중요합니다.

3. Amazon RDS SQL Server Developer Edition 제약 사항

AWS 공식 문서에 명시된 제약 사항도 확인했습니다. 이 부분은 블로그에서 반드시 짚고 가야 하는 내용입니다.

사용 목적 제한

  • 개발, 테스트, 데모 환경 전용
  • 운영(Production) 워크로드 사용 불가
  • 라이선스 조건 위반 시 책임은 사용자에게 있음

기능적 제약

  • SQL Server 기능 자체는 Enterprise와 동일
  • RDS의 기존 제약은 동일하게 적용됨
    (예: OS 접근 불가, 일부 서버 레벨 설정 제한)

4. 생성 및 설정 방식 요약

공식 문서 기준으로 확인한 내용입니다.

  • RDS 콘솔 또는 CLI에서
    • 엔진: SQL Server
    • Edition: Developer Edition
    • License model: License included
  • 기존 SQL Server RDS와 생성 플로우는 동일
  • Multi-AZ, 백업, 모니터링 등 RDS 기본 기능 그대로 사용 가능

특별한 추가 설정 없이도 기존 RDS SQL Server 생성 방식과 동일하게 사용할 수 있는 구조입니다.

5. 기술적으로 의미 있는 변화

이 기능은 단순히 “에디션 하나가 추가됐다” 수준이 아닙니다.

  • Enterprise 기능 검증을 위한 현실적인 개발 환경을 공식 지원
  • 로컬 개발 환경과 실제 운영 환경 간 기능 격차 제거
  • SQL Server 기반 시스템을 운영하는 팀에서
    개발/스테이징 비용 최적화 가능

특히, SQL Server를 사용하는 중대형 시스템에서는 개발 환경 비용과 운영 환경 일관성 문제를 동시에 해결할 수 있습니다.